Resting in the village of Frosterley in the Durham Dales is this charming cottage surrounded by beautiful rugged countryside. Frosterley is a small village lying on the edge of the North Pennines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ty (aonb) with exhilarating landscapes to discover. Wander down to the village and find a pub, supermarket and fish and chip bar, whilst 3 miles on either side of Frosterley you will find cafes, an Italian restaurant, gift shops, an art gallery and a range of takeaways and pubs. Jump onboard the Weardale railway heritage line, a seasonal 18 mile journey that stops at the nearby villages of Stanhope and Wolsingham. Take a scenic drive over the North Pennines to Barnard Castle (22 miles), rich in history with the ruins of its medieval castle overlooking the river. For those who cannot get enough of the scenery, nearby you will find the scenic hiking trails of the Weardale Way, Harehope Quarry Project, Pine Woods and Warren s Peak. Step inside this lovely cottage, built in the 1800s and retaining much of its original character, guests will find stone floors, beamed ceilings and fireplaces. Make your way into the cosy lounge with a wood burning stove at its heart. Relax back on the sofa, warmed by the heat of the flames, and cuddle up to watch a film on the TV or listen to some music. When it's time to eat, venture into the kitchen and rustle up a hearty meal; the kitchen is well equipped to make your stay extremely comfortable. Dine around the country style table planning your next day out. At the end of the day, make your way up the stairs to discover two lovely bedrooms, a king size with glorious countryside views to the front and a twin room with Feather and Black beds at the back offering views over the garden and along the valley. In the morning, kick start your day with a refreshing shower or a long soak in the bath before embarking on your next adventure. From the kitchen, step outside to the well kept garden, where you can take your morning coffee while listening to the local birdsong. Enjoy alfresco dining around the garden table during the summer months in this peaceful setting. The astronomers among you will want to take advantage of the cottage's dark sky location, making it the perfect place to watch the stars at night. Need to know: 2 bedrooms 1 king size, 1 twin bedroom. 1 bathroom bath/electric shower over and WC. Electric hob/oven, smeg fridge/freezer, microwave, Nespresso coffee machine and washing machine. Highchair available. Log burner (basket of logs provided). Freeview TV, DVD player and CD player. Rear garden with garden dining set. Off street parking for 1 car further parking available on the green area 150ft away (subject to availability). Shop 0.5 miles, pub 0.8 miles. Please note: Due to the property's age, the stone stairs to the first floor are uneven.
